(2) An aquarium's base has an area
of 120 square inches. Its height is
11 inches. Calculate the volume.

Respuesta :

mhanifa
mhanifa mhanifa
  • 19-05-2023

Answer:

  • 1320 in³

----------------------

The volume is the product of base area and height.

Find the volume:

  • V = base * height
  • V = 120*11
  • V = 1320 in³
